Is sometimes used in Scripture for speaker, Exodus 4:16 Jeremiah 15:19 . God spoke with Moses "mouth to mouth," Numbers 12.8 , that is, condescendingly and clearly. The law was to be "in the mouth" of the Hebrews, Exodus 13:9 , often rehearsed and talked of. "The rod of his mouth," Isaiah 11:4 , and the sharp sword, Revelation 1:16 , denote the power of Christ's word to convict, control, and judge; compare Isaiah 49:2 Hebrews 4:12 . The Hebrew word for mouth is often translated "command," Genesis 45:21 Job 39:27 Ecclesiastes 8:2; and the unclean spirits out of the mouth of the dragon, Revelation 16:14 , are the ready executors of his commands.
